Count D'Orgel's Ball Historians “for the lame”The Count D'Orgel's Ball is a story published in July 1924, shortly after the author's death, and is considered one of the masterpieces of moral literature. Taking place in 1920s Paris, it tells the story of a great love that seems impossible, delving deeply into the feelings, thoughts, and behavior of its characters. A story that reveals the lives of feudal lords and nobles who indulge in extravagance, the love that arises in the heart of nobleman
